Troy Brown with a 6'10.25" wingspan and an 8'9" standing reach (assuming this isn't a typo) could grow just a tad and be big enough to play at the 4 by today's standards. He'd need to gain 12-15 lbs (currently 208 lbs), but he's likely to do that within a year or two, given his age.
